Multilayer coating with digital printing
A multilayer coating system for metal substrates is described. The coating system includes a digital printed coating layer applied to the substrate and a clear coating layer applied over the digital printed coating layer. The digital printed coating layer is applied using a jet process and the inks used are inorganic inks. The described multilayer coating system demonstrates a color change (ΔE) of no more than 5 units.
1 . A multi-layer weatherable coating system comprising:
a basecoat layer comprising at least one polyester resin component applied on a planar metal surface that forms at least part of a garage door;
a patterned coating comprising an ink composition deposited over the basecoat layer on the planar metal surface, wherein the ink composition comprises a 100% solids inorganic ink system; and
an electron beam-cured clear coating layer comprising 20 to 40% by weight of a urethane (meth) acrylate resin component applied over the patterned coating,
wherein the electron beam-cured layer is applied in a coil coating process, the patterned coating is applied by a process integrated into the coil coating application process, and wherein the coating system demonstrates a color change (ΔE) of no more than 5 units on exposure to UV radiation of at least 500 hours.
